big gap
definitions
-
A large physical opening, void, or space between two objects or surfaces.ja: 大きな隙間
-
A significant difference, discrepancy, or imbalance between two things, such as social classes, opinions, or levels of knowledge.ja: 大きな隔たり
-
A long period of time between two events or occurrences.ja: 大きな空白
examples
-
There is a big gap between the door and the floor.
ドアと床の間に大きな隙間があります。
-
There is a big gap between the rich and the poor.
富裕層と貧困層の間には大きな隔たりがあります。
-
There was a big gap in his employment history.
彼の職歴には大きな空白期間がありました。
